Extension of UN peacekeeping mission’s mandate in Lebanon
Lebanese President Joseph Aoun welcomed the extension of the mandate of the United Nations Interim Force in Lebanon (UNIFIL), calling it a result of broad international consensus to support stability in southern Lebanon. Aoun made the remarks in a phone call with French President Emmanuel Macron, after the United Nations Security Council (UNSC) unanimously voted to extend UNIFIL’s mandate for a final term through Dec. 31, 2026, Lebanon’s Preside…
